can anyone tell me the best way to utilize unflavored protien powder?



Recommended Posts

I bought it at GNC and the guy didn't know what to do with it either,,,can anyone give me ideas. i just want to add it into something but he said it would change the consistency, but i thought i could just sprinkle it in my food or Soup or something like that, cause i already drink EAS Myoplex and like that as a protien drink....:blink: thanks, vicki

Share this post


Link to post
Share on other sites

Def. add it to fruit smoothies.

I use www.unjury.com, so I can't speak for the GNC kind or others.

I add half a scoop of unflavored to my coffee in the morning. So I get my coffee (sticking with decaf) and add some SF coffeemate Creamer, then I add half a scoop.. that's 10 extra grams of Protein just with my coffee.

My nutritionist suggested I make mashed potatoes and throw some of it in there too. She also suggested making pudding (the instant kind) and using the unflavored or the choc or vanilla flavored. Other suggestions are adding it to oatmeal, adding it to yogurt, anything you can think of where you could hide it! I haven't tried any of these yet, but I may try the pudding one soon.

Good luck!

I thought you couldn't add the Protein Powder to hot liquids...no warmer than 180 degrees?...which is just barely warm. At least, that's the way it was when I used the powders?utm_source=BariatricPal&utm_medium=Affiliate&utm_campaign=CommentLink" target="_ad" data-id="1" >unjury chicken Soup flavor. So do you let your coffee cool down all the way, or make iced coffee, before adding it in?

I use the coffemate sugar free french vanilla creamer. It's stored in the fridge, and it cools my coffee down enough to make the Protein powder dissolve easily. I swear I do not taste it or smell it. Now if I add a little too much, like if I did a whole scoop, I think i would. But I manage to sneak in 1/2 scoop, and it works.

I never could find a good way to use the unflavored stuff. I could smell it and taste it in everything I tried, and it made most everything inedible to me. My husband used to put it in his Crystal Light drinks, and got in lots of Protein that way right at first after surgery. He didn't notice it at all as long as he added a flavor to his Water and then just one scoop of protein per 16.9 oz. bottle. I have had much more luck with the flavored versions. I like almost anything chocolate flavored, so even chocolate protein tastes good to me.

I was just reading about this on another site. People suggested putting it in yogurt, cottage cheese, scrambled eggs, and any cold liquid mixture. Someone also mentioned that if you put it in something cool you can heat it very slowly and it doesn't clump.
